On Tuesday afternoon Chris Brown walked out of a Los Angeles court room, with five years of felony probation, 52 weeks of domestic-violence counseling and 180-days of community labor on his plate, after formal sentencing in the assault case against ex-girlfriend Rihanna. The judge’s ruling seems to be only part one of Brown’s repentance, however, as the R&B singer sat down with CNN’s Larry King the following day for his first exclusive interview since the infamous February assault.

Bruno, Borat and Ali G creator Sacha Baron Cohen has given a rare television interview as himself on the David Letterman Show.
Sacha, looking smart and relaxed in the clip, explained how he set about interviewing a terrorist for his new movie, Bruno, which opens in the UK tomorrow (July 10).
He tells David: “We thought one thing would a comedian interviewing a terrorist which I think has never been done before – with good reason. It’s not that easy to find an actual terrorist. In fact, your government has been looking for one for about nine years.”
